//! Pattern 1: Simple While Loop → JoinIR Lowering
|
|
//!
|
|
//! Phase 188 Task 188-4: Implementation of simple while loop pattern.
|
|
//!
|
|
//! ## Pattern Characteristics
|
|
//!
|
|
//! - Single loop variable (carrier)
|
|
//! - Simple condition
|
|
//! - NO control flow statements (no break, no continue, no nested if)
|
|
//! - Natural exit only (condition becomes false)
|
|
//!
|
|
//! ## Example
|
|
//!
|
|
//! ```nyash
|
|
//! local i = 0
|
|
//! loop(i < 3) {
|
|
//! print(i)
|
|
//! i = i + 1
|
|
//! }
|
|
//! return 0
|
|
//! ```
|
|
//!
|
|
//! ## JoinIR Transformation
|
|
//!
|
|
//! ```text
|
|
//! fn main():
|
|
//! i_init = 0
|
|
//! return loop_step(i_init)
|
|
//!
|
|
//! fn loop_step(i):
|
|
//! exit_cond = !(i < 3)
|
|
//! Jump(k_exit, [], cond=exit_cond) // early return
|
|
//! print(i)
|
|
//! i_next = i + 1
|
|
//! Call(loop_step, [i_next]) // tail recursion
|
|
//!
|
|
//! fn k_exit():
|
|
//! return 0
|
|
//! ```
